Kuwait Fire Tragedy: IAF Aircraft Carrying Bodies of 45 Indians Arrives at Cochin International Airport

Brief by Shorts91 Newsdesk / 06:19am on 14 Jun 2024,Friday India Global

An Indian Air Force aircraft carrying the bodies of 45 Indians killed in the Mangaf fire in Kuwait arrived at Cochin International Airport on Friday. Minister of State for External Affairs Kirti Vardhan Singh accompanied the remains. Authorities confirmed the identities through DNA tests. The tragedy claimed 49 lives and injured 50 others. Chief Minister Pinarayi Vijayan and other officials were present to receive the bodies. Of the 45 deceased, 31 are from southern states and 14 will be sent to Delhi. Kuwaiti authorities attributed the fire to an electrical fault.
